Your Ultimate Guide to Losing Belly Fat
So, you're seriously wanting to shed that stubborn belly fat? It’s a typical goal, and thankfully, it's absolutely achievable! This guide will break down the critical steps involved. Forget quick fixes; we're focusing on sustainable lifestyle changes. First, nutrition is paramount – you need to nourish your body with wholesome foods like lean protein, fruits, vegetables, and healthy fats while restricting processed foods, sugary drinks, and excessive carbohydrates. Exercise plays a vital role too; incorporate both cardio activities (like brisk walking) and strength training to incinerate calories and build muscle. Strength training particularly helps because it increases your metabolic rate, which means you'll continue burning more calories even when at rest. Finally, don’t underestimate the power of lifestyle factors like getting enough sleep (sufficient slumber) to manage stress and maintain hormonal balance – all crucial for fat removal. Weight Loss Myths Disproven: What Really Works
So, you're trying to shed weight? You’ve likely heard countless claims about the “easiest” way to achieve it. Unfortunately, many of these are just myths. Let's examine several common weight loss notions and separate fact from fiction. Forget the extreme approaches; sustainable change involves grasping what *actually* helps.
- Myth: Skipping meals accelerates metabolism. Truth: It usually hinders it, leading to overeating later.
- Myth: "Detox" cleanses eliminate toxins and promote rapid weight loss. Truth: Your body has its own efficient systems (liver & kidneys) – these are often just expensive water losses.
- Myth: You need to do endless cardio for fat burning. Truth: Strength training builds muscle, which increases your resting metabolic rate—helping you burn more calories even when you’re at rest.
- Myth: All calories are created equal. Truth: While calorie intake is important, the *source* of those calories – protein, carbs, and fats – significantly impacts your body's response and overall health.
The most effective approach to weight loss is a combination of a balanced diet, regular physical activity you enjoy, and realistic goals. Focus on making gradual, long-term changes that you can maintain for a healthier, happier you—avoiding the pitfalls these common misconceptions is key.
